Title: How to make chocolate crackles
Ingredients
4 cups Rice Bubbles
1 cup of Icing Sugar
1 cup of Coconut
3 Tablespoon of cocoa
250 grams Kremelta
Paper baking cups
Method
1. Melt the Kremelta in a saucepan over the stove or in the microwave
2. Place the baking cups on a plate
3. Pour 4 cups of Rice Bubbles into the bowl
4. Measure 1 cup of Icing Sugar and pour it into the bowl
5. Measure 1 cup of coconut into the bowl
6. Measure the cocoa and pour it into the bowl
7. Pour the Kremelta into the bowl
8. Stir the Ingredients together
9. Spoon the Chocolate crackles into the baking cups
10. Refrigerate the Chocolate Crackles for three hours
11. Take the Chocolate Crackles out of the fridge and eat the
Enjoy
Serves: 50
